RomanceWhy Watching the News Is the Most Dangerous Habit You Think Is Harmless by CandyOps(op):
How News Exposure Shapes Your Mind in Ways You Don’t Realize

The news is everywhere. On your phone, on the TV, on your feed.

It never stops.

And while you think you’re just staying informed, the truth is the news is shaping your mind in ways you don’t even notice.

Our chimpanzee brains are wired for danger. ⚠️
Every negative headline — fear, outrage, disaster — lights up the stress circuits inside you.

That constant drip of cortisol makes you feel more anxious and more on edge, even when your own life is calm subconsciously.

Slowly, you start to see the world as darker than it really is.

It doesn’t stop there.
The endless scroll trains your mind to skim, click, react, and move on.

Deep focus? Reflection? Slipping away.
You’re being conditioned to think in headlines, not in depth. Same with doom scrolling

The fix isn’t to cut off completely — it’s to take control.
Pick your moments to check the news.
Seek out long-form stories instead of clickbait.
Balance the doom with something hopeful.

Because if you don’t, the news won’t just inform you…
It will rewire you.

Most people think the news comes and goes. You watch, you scroll, you move on.

But the subconscious mind doesn’t work like that.
It holds onto images, words, and tones — replaying them long after you’ve put the phone down.

That’s why one tragic headline can follow you for the entire day without you even realizing it.

Psychologists call this the negativity bias — our brains are built to cling to the bad more than the good.

One study from the University of British Columbia found that people remember negative news stories longer and with more detail than positive ones.

Your subconscious keeps replaying those details, shaping your emotions in the background.
So you may feel heavy, restless, or irritable without even linking it back to the news.

Over time, this quiet drip becomes a pattern.


Anxious thoughts become your default setting.
You see the world as unsafe, unstable, or hostile — even if your personal life is fine.

It’s not because the world is worse, it’s because your mind has been trained to expect the worst.

The danger is long-term.
Research has linked constant exposure to negative news with higher levels of stress hormones, disrupted sleep, and even symptoms of depression.


Your subconscious isn’t built to process a global feed of disasters every day.


It’s built to keep you alive — so it treats every headline like a personal threat.

The good news is awareness is power.
Limit the cycle of breaking news.
Choose thoughtful reporting over doomscrolling.


Feed your mind stories of solutions and hope, so your subconscious has something better to hold onto.

Because in the end, the news isn’t just informing you. It’s programming you.

And if you don’t take control, your subconscious will carry that negativity with you — quietly, constantly, and long term.
